卡诺图是逻辑设计中的一个重要工具,它通过图形化的方式帮助我们简化逻辑表达式,从而简化电路设计。本文将深入探讨卡诺图相邻逻辑门的概念,并揭示其如何帮助我们解锁复杂电路设计的简洁密码。
引言
在数字电路设计中,逻辑门是构建各种逻辑功能的基础。然而,复杂的逻辑电路往往包含大量的逻辑门,这使得电路的设计和维护变得复杂。卡诺图作为一种图形化工具,通过将逻辑表达式以图形形式展示,帮助我们直观地识别和简化逻辑表达式。
卡诺图的基本概念
1. 逻辑函数
逻辑函数是数字电路设计的基础,它描述了输入与输出之间的关系。在卡诺图中,逻辑函数通常用布尔表达式表示。
2. 卡诺图的结构
卡诺图是一个二维图形,它由一系列的单元格组成。每个单元格代表一个唯一的输入组合,单元格内的值表示该组合下的输出。
3. 卡诺图的简化
卡诺图的核心功能是简化逻辑表达式。通过识别相邻的单元格(即共享边界的单元格),我们可以合并它们,从而简化表达式。
相邻逻辑门的概念
1. 相邻单元格
在卡诺图中,相邻单元格是指共享边界的单元格。这些单元格的合并是简化逻辑表达式的基础。
2. 相邻逻辑门
相邻逻辑门是指在逻辑电路中,通过相邻单元格合并得到的逻辑门。这些逻辑门可以是与门、或门、非门等。
卡诺图相邻逻辑门的实例
1. 简单逻辑函数
假设我们有一个简单的逻辑函数F(A, B) = AB + A’B,我们可以通过卡诺图来简化它。
步骤一:绘制卡诺图
首先,我们绘制一个2变量的卡诺图,并在相应的单元格中标记逻辑函数的值。
AB
00 01
10 11
+---+---+
| | |
+---+---+
步骤二:合并相邻单元格
接下来,我们合并相邻的单元格,找到可以合并的最大单元。
步骤三:简化逻辑表达式
通过合并,我们可以得到简化的逻辑表达式。
2. 复杂逻辑函数
对于更复杂的逻辑函数,我们可以使用类似的方法,通过卡诺图来简化表达式。
卡诺图相邻逻辑门的优势
1. 简化设计
通过卡诺图相邻逻辑门的简化,我们可以减少电路中的逻辑门数量,从而简化电路设计。
2. 提高效率
简化后的电路不仅设计更简单,而且运行效率更高。
3. 降低成本
简化设计可以减少所需的硬件资源,从而降低成本。
总结
卡诺图相邻逻辑门是数字电路设计中的一种强大工具,它通过图形化的方式帮助我们简化逻辑表达式,从而简化电路设计。通过本文的探讨,我们揭示了卡诺图相邻逻辑门的概念和优势,希望能帮助读者更好地理解和应用这一工具。
